Ingeteam has developed and supplied the first 15 units of its Yaw Backup System to an offshore project in the United Kingdom. The company began the development of this system in 2020 to offer the market a reliable and more efficient alternative to diesel systems responsible for pivoting the nacelle on the tower when there are strong wind conditions and the wind turbine is disconnected from the electrical grid for power outages caused by weather. The system is made up of a frequency converter along with a stack of batteries that provide energy to the wind turbine so that it can withstand the extreme weather that usually occurs on the high seas, keeping the rotor aligned in the direction of the wind. The forces acting on the blades and the structure are thus minimized, avoiding possible breakdowns and significant damage to the wind turbine components. It is a sustainable solution that guarantees an instant response in adverse weather conditions, to reduce the mechanical stresses of the wind turbine by directly feeding the Yaw Backup System, thus maintaining the safety of all its components and avoiding economic losses. In addition, the Yaw Backup System also provides an emergency electrical power source to support essential loads such as control and communications, among other systems. These systems are also used in parks located in areas affected by typhoons and other adverse weather conditions. However, the increase in the size of offshore wind turbines means that they are increasingly sensitive to the loads supported and, in these situations, solutions such as the Yaw Backup System become essential. Specifically, this project located in the United Kingdom has already received and installed the first units of this system developed by Ingeteam, making it a coherent project aligned with its mission of generating clean energy by avoiding mechanics powered by fossil fuels. The energy stored in the batteries that enable the movement of the nacelle comes from the wind turbine itself, which contributes to the sustainability of the projects and makes it 100% renewable. Mon, 29 Jan 2024 13:40:00 GMT f1397696-738c-4295-afcd-943feb885714:3601 https://www.ingeteam.com/cl/Pressroom/tabid/3391/articleType/ArticleView/articleId/3597/language/es-CL/Ingeteam-reinforces-its-commitment-to-environmental-transparency-with-the-calculation-of-the-carbon-footprint-for-its-photovoltaic-and-battery-inverters.aspx#Comments 0 https://www.ingeteam.com/DesktopModules/DnnForge%20-%20NewsArticles/RssComments.aspx?TabID=3391&ModuleID=3021&ArticleID=3597 https://www.ingeteam.com:443/DesktopModules/DnnForge%20-%20NewsArticles/Tracking/Trackback.aspx?ArticleID=3597&PortalID=12&TabID=3391 Ingeteam reinforces its commitment to environmental transparency with the calculation of the carbon footprint for its photovoltaic and battery inverters. https://www.ingeteam.com/cl/Pressroom/tabid/3391/articleType/ArticleView/articleId/3597/language/es-CL/Ingeteam-reinforces-its-commitment-to-environmental-transparency-with-the-calculation-of-the-carbon-footprint-for-its-photovoltaic-and-battery-inverters.aspx The Product Carbon Footprint (PCF) is an environmental indicator that aims to reflect the total greenhouse gases emitted by direct or indirect effect of the product. The PCF is calculated from the CO2 footprints of the raw materials, plus the CO2 footprints of the production processes involved, each weighted with the efficiency factors from raw material to finished product. Ingeteam's commitment to environmental transparency in the development of its products is reinforced by quantifying their environmental impact. Along these lines, Ingeteam and Grunver Sustainability have worked on the process of compiling life cycle data for the C Series central inverter for large photovoltaic and battery plants, and also for its hybrid inverter aimed at residential systems: INGECON SUN STORAGE 1Play. In both cases, data processing has been carried out to obtain the calculation and verification of the carbon footprint. This study has a cradle-to-grave scope, i.e. the environmental impact has been calculated from the extraction of raw materials to the end-of-life management of the product. More specifically, among all the parameters obtained, the study reveals a carbon footprint of 1.81E+05 kg CO2 equivalent for the central inverter and 1.48E+03 kg CO2 equivalent for the hybrid inverter for residential systems. The study was conducted according to ISO standards UNE EN ISO 14067:2019 and PCR for electric and electrical products and systems EPD Italy 007 (Rev. 3.0) and PCR ParU for Power Inverters: EPD Italy 032 of the EPD Italy type III eco-labeling system. The power electronics needed to power and control the electrolyzers are becoming an increasingly important part of the total cost of a hydrogen production plant. As plants grow in size and reach gigawatt power levels, it is necessary to develop economies of scale to manufacture cost- and time-optimized components and equipment. Ingeteam, thanks to a well-developed supply chain and a proven mass production line, will supply this new equipment to large electrolyzer plants, contributing to their viability and making hydrogen a competitive decarbonization solution. The new INGECON H2 E-lyzer converter has a very high current density and is capable of supplying 6,000 amps of DC for electrolyser electrolysis use. Ingeteam has also developed a solution that integrates two such converters combined with the rest of the elements on the same platform or full skid, to facilitate direct connection to the medium voltage grid, thus obtaining 12,000 amps of output current. By integrating state-of-the-art IGBT technology, the new converter ensures a very high quality DC power supply and full power factor control, thus adapting to the needs of large-scale renewable hydrogen production. The unit is water-cooled, therefore the compartment where most of the components are located has an IP65 degree of protection, and can be installed outdoors without the need for additional protection. Ingeteam has renewed its UL certification to market its Indar wind generators in the U.S. and Canada. The company, which has held this certification since 2012, owns a factory in Milwaukee, WI from where it manufactures generators to be installed in North American wind farms. To obtain this validation, a certifying company must confirm that the generators comply with UL (Underwriters Laboratories) standards, a highly valued and demanded requirement in the sector. Specifically, the generator insulation system must be validated in an external laboratory based on said standards, fixing the insulation materials and layers, with tests lasting one year, subjecting the insulation system to stress conditions that simulate the design life (the current standard in the sector being above 20-25 years). During the prototype validation process with the client, the certifying company supervises the tests on the company's test bench, in accordance with the limits of the applicable regulations. From this point on, the design of the insulation system, safety and protection distances, as well as the need for certain components with their own UL certification, are established as part of the certification. The serial-produced Indar wind generators undergo quarterly certification reviews to ensure they continue to meet the established design and validated standards. This requires that the materials and criteria are the same as those that have been validated in the laboratory and the test bench, limiting any modification. Previously, the hamlet only had access to electricity for 4 hours a day, but Ingeteam provided equipment and services to install a solar energy supply and storage system. The quality of life for the 750 inhabitants of Vila Restauração in the Amazon improved considerably, having transitioned from a mere 4 hours of electricity a day to an uninterrupted supply. Moreover, the energy they now have at their disposal is clean, as opposed to their previous reliance on a diesel generator unit. This R&D project was developed by Alsol Energias Renováveis ​​(Energisa Group company). The energy generation and storage system consist of four solar inverters with their respective solar panels; four storage inverters with their respective battery banks; two biodiesel generator units and low-voltage switchgear for microgrid automation and protection. System operation During the day photovoltaic power generation not only supplies electricity to the hamlet but also recharges the batteries that will come into operation later in the day. Therefore, during the night the hamlet is powered by the batteries charged during the day. What happens when it is cloudy? When it is cloudy, the battery charge is low and the photovoltaic system cannot provide enough energy to power the hamlet and recharge the batteries, at which point the generator unit is activated to provide the necessary energy to the hamlet and also charge the batteries. It should be noted that the entire operation of this microgrid, consisting of a generation system on the one hand and an energy storage system on the other, is automated. This enables systems to be created in which photovoltaic energy generation can be adjusted by varying microgrid frequency to avoid overloading battery banks and meet the demand of the hamlet's residents, thus achieving a balance between energy generation, consumption and storage Thu, 24 Mar 2022 08:10:00 GMT f1397696-738c-4295-afcd-943feb885714:3337 https://www.ingeteam.com/cl/Pressroom/tabid/3391/articleType/ArticleView/articleId/3333/language/es-CL/Ingeteam-is-supplying-its-solar-inverters-for-two-Mercury-Renew-projects-in-Brazil-totaling-210-MWp.aspx#Comments 0 https://www.ingeteam.com/DesktopModules/DnnForge%20-%20NewsArticles/RssComments.aspx?TabID=3391&ModuleID=3021&ArticleID=3333 https://www.ingeteam.com:443/DesktopModules/DnnForge%20-%20NewsArticles/Tracking/Trackback.aspx?ArticleID=3333&PortalID=12&TabID=3391 Ingeteam is supplying its solar inverters for two Mercury Renew projects in Brazil, totaling 210 MWp https://www.ingeteam.com/cl/Pressroom/tabid/3391/articleType/ArticleView/articleId/3333/language/es-CL/Ingeteam-is-supplying-its-solar-inverters-for-two-Mercury-Renew-projects-in-Brazil-totaling-210-MWp.aspx   The supply is divided into two PV plants: Brígida (80 MWp) and Bon Nome (130 MWp).   The solar inverters were manufactured at Ingeteam's PV plant located in the state of São Paulo, and the medium voltage skids were also assembled in Brazil.   Ingeteam has already concluded the supply of 108 solar inverters made in Brazil and 32 substations or power stations also assembled in the country. The hub, which is located in Elche in southern Spain, at a site that is very close to Alicante airport, offers two charging stations, one in each direction of the highway and with a rated output power of 4MW. The stations comprise sixteen RAPID ST units with different output powers and offering the possibility of charging up to sixteen vehicles simultaneously. Four of the points permit charging at 400 kW, the highest power on the market, making it possible to fully charge a vehicle in approximately five minutes. The other twelve points have a charging range of up to 200 kW. What is more, this charging station is equipped with the new INGECON SUN STORAGE Power Series B. This is an AC/DC converter that generates a direct current bus for the RAPID ST, in other words, it converts alternating to direct current and the Ingeteam chargers are then responsible for adapting the voltage to each vehicle's specific requirements. A new battery converter As well as being the first large-scale solar plant in Spain to incorporate batteries, this project offers a further novel feature with the inclusion of the battery storage system within the PV plant as a distributed system with a DC-Coupling configuration. In this mode, the batteries are installed within the solar array and the battery converters share the DC connection with the PV inverters, offering the following key technical advantages: Possibility of utilizing the extra power from the solar panels that is not used in the peak production hours (Clipping Recapture). This makes it possible to minimize the losses by charging the batteries from the PV array, given that the connection between the panels and the batteries only passes through the DC/DC converter. The discharge is also more efficient, due to the fact that no power transformer is required, in contrast to the AC connected solution. This novel technique to create a hybrid PV generation system with battery energy storage, was made possible thanks to the development by Ingeteam of a new battery converter: the DC-DC series of the INGECON SUN STORAGE Power family. This converter is coupled to the DC input of a PV inverter, thereby obtaining in practice a hybrid central inverter with a direct coupling to the solar panels and batteries alike and with a single AC output that is coupled to the LV/MV transformer. Ingeteam's three-phase inverters INGECON SUN 20TL M, INGECON SUN 33TL M, INGECON SUN 100TL PRO and INGECON SUN 160TL PRO are already being manufactured with these new improvements, which allow them to withstand a higher input current to be able to use them with the new models of more powerful photovoltaic panels. This means savings in DC cabling in the entire photovoltaic plant, since as each inverter admits more current per string, the total number of strings required is reduced. This also leads to savings in construction work. Thus, solar inverters between 20 and 33 kW with two Maximum Power Point Trackers (MPPT) now support up to 12A for each PV connector. The INGECON SUN 100TL PRO solar inverter supports up to 15A per connector, while the INGECON SUN 160TL PRO inverter now supports a maximum current of 20A per photovoltaic connector. This inverter designed for large photovoltaic plants is suitable for solar panel models designed with both 182 mm and 210 mm wafers, which already exceed 600 W of power. It involves a new advanced control system for ships transporting high-tonnage parts, which performs a comprehensive analysis of on board elements when the vessel's crane is used for loading and unloading manoeuvres, and which automatically compensates the water in hold tanks to stabilise the vessel. The project has gained €500,000 in investment, and the support of the Basque Government's Hazitek Business R&D programme and the European Regional Development Fund (ERDF). It should be noted that these heavy Floating Crane Installation Vessels specialise in the transport of parts for offshore oil platforms or offshore wind turbines and can have a considerable tonnage. Unlike jackup rigs, crane vessels are faster at facilities as they do not use anchor legs, although they do require stability and positioning control due to the large size and weight of the parts they handle. Loading and unloading manoeuvres are delicate, as the crane can cause the vessel to heel or even sink. To prevent the ship from capsizing, heeling must be compensated by a counterweight to ensure the stability of the vessel by using water to fill different hold tanks in the ship. By installing pumps in the hold, it is possible to speed up the transfer of water between on board storage compartments, and thereby act as a counterweight to adapt the load level during the operation. The new advanced control system, developed by Ingeteam, enables this weight compensation system to be automated in order to stabilise manoeuvres at sea, by employing a mathematical model capable of predicting the torsional moment, anticipating its effect, and maintaining stability. By monitoring all of the ship’s elements via the installation of sensors, real-time measurements can be obtained of the ship's inclination, or tank levels, and used to produce a simulation of the distribution of the weight and forces in the ship. The system operates pumps to transfer the water between the different tanks, counteracting any possible imbalances that may be created during a manoeuvre. This project, called Antiheeling 4.0, represents a breakthrough in the sector, as it automates stabilisation by controlling ship ballast and draught during loading and unloading operations at sea, thus ensuring safer and more effective manoeuvres.
